About this bottle

Michter's US*1 American Whiskey is an unblended American whiskey, distinct from Michter's bourbon and rye in that it doesn't meet the aging requirements to carry a 'straight' designation, giving the distillery more flexibility in the final blend. It's aged in Michter's own toasted-and-charred barrels and bottled at 83.4 proof, non-chill filtered. Expect a smooth, mellow palate of caramel, vanilla, and light oak spice, without the sharper edges of a younger straight whiskey. It's built as an easy, versatile whiskey — approachable enough for someone new to American whiskey, and mixable enough for a bartender's well. Michter's built its reputation on small-batch consistency, and this bottle reflects that house style.

How to drink Michter's US*1 American Whiskey

It's built for versatility — a solid whiskey sour or old fashioned base, and smooth enough to sip neat or on the rocks without demanding much attention. A good everyday bottle rather than an occasion pour.

A resurrection rather than a survival. The Pennsylvania distillery that carried the Michter's name — Bomberger's, in Schaefferstown — went bankrupt and fell silent in 1989. The name was revived and rebuilt in Kentucky in the 1990s. Worth having on the shelf as a reminder that not every historic distillery made it through, and the ones that came back did it deliberately.

Questions about this bottle

What's the best way to serve US*1 American Whiskey?

Serve it neat or on the rocks in a rocks glass; it's aged in toasted-and-charred barrels, which give it a rounder profile than most bourbons.

What cocktails work well with US*1 American Whiskey?

It works well in an Old Fashioned, a Manhattan, or a Whiskey Sour, where its sweetness and oak balance the other ingredients.

What's distinctive about the barrels Michter's uses?

They're toasted before charring, an extra step that adds a layer of caramelized wood sugar.
